Gemcitabine + ivonescimab is an investigational combination therapy being evaluated for the treatment of advanced non-small cell lung cancer (NSCLC). Ivonescimab (also known as AK112 or SMT-112) is a humanized bispecific monoclonal antibody that concurrently targets Programmed Cell Death Protein 1 (PD-1) and Vascular Endothelial Growth Factor (VEGF), designed to promote anti-tumor immune responses while inhibiting angiogenesis within the tumor microenvironment. Gemcitabine is a pyrimidine antimetabolite chemotherapy agent that inhibits DNA synthesis and has demonstrated potential immunostimulatory effects, such as increasing T-cell infiltration and reducing immunosuppressive cell populations. This combination is currently being studied in the Phase II ORIGIN2 trial (SAKK 18/25), sponsored by the Swiss Cancer Institute (SAKK), specifically for patients whose disease has progressed following prior chemoimmunotherapy.
